Ruffin and Hammond are part of a 2021 recruiting class that also includes Wyoming 7-footer Lawson Lovering and D.C.-area prospect Quincy Allen, both of whom are rated as four-star recruits by 247Sports.com. The Buffs lost Tyler Bey (reigning Pac-12 DPOY) from last year’s 21-win team, but bring back Wright (first-team All-Pac-12) and gain arguably coach Tad Boyle’s most talented signing class in his 11th season.
